Charles Frederick Guy 1893–1970 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 27 APR 1893
Birth Location: Bendigo, Victoria, Australia
Death Date: 20 NOV 1970
Death Location: Fawkner Cemetery, Victoria, Australia
Father: Charles Guy
Mother: Eliza Bradley
Spouse(s): Isabel Cumming
Children(s): Bernice Guy, John Guy
Charles Frederick Guy was born in 1893 in Bendigo, Victoria, Australia, the child of Charles Alfred Guy And Eliza Mayne Bradley. Charles Frederick Guy married Isabel Cumming, and had children including Bernice Flora Guy, John Cameron Guy. Charles Frederick Guy passed away in 1970 in Fawkner Cemetery, Victoria, Australia.
